ng-class是AngularJS中的一个指令,用于动态地添加或移除HTML元素的CSS类。它可以根据表达式的值来决定是否添加指定的CSS类。
当ng-class的表达式为false时,它仍然会显示的原因可能是由于以下几种情况:
解决方法:确保ng-class的表达式返回的是布尔类型的值,可以使用逻辑运算符或比较运算符来得到布尔结果。
解决方法:检查ng-class的表达式是否正确,确保语法和逻辑的正确性。
解决方法:检查ng-class指定的CSS类名称是否正确,确保与HTML元素中定义的CSS类名称一致。
总结起来,如果ng-class的表达式返回的是布尔类型的false,并且表达式没有错误,同时CSS类名称也正确,那么ng-class不应该显示。如果仍然显示,可能需要进一步检查代码逻辑或提供更多的上下文信息来排查问题。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云